Crisis-hit Tunisia receives 1.5m Covid vaccines from Italy
Crisis-hit Tunisia, which has one of the world's highest coronavirus death rates, received 1.5 million Covid-19 vaccine doses from Italy, the president's office announced.
President Kais Saied, who a week ago dismissed the prime minister and suspended parliament, was on hand to receive the consignment and launched a stinging attack on the performance of the ousted government.
“More than a year has gone by, meeting after meeting has been held, and yet people are being hospitalised and dying by the hundreds each day,” he said.
Apart from political and economic crises, the North African country of almost 12 million inhabitants has suffered close to 20,000 Covid-related deaths, according to AFP.
